What is an Inverter Welding Machine?
An inverter welding machine is a contemporary gadget that uses inverter technology to convert direct present (DC) into a high-frequency AC current. This conversion allows for more control over the welding arc, leading to better stability and performance. Checking an inverter Buy MIG/MAG Welding Machine machine includes a number of steps. Below is a generic testing treatment that can be adapted based upon particular requirements:

Initial Inspection:
Check the machine for any visible damage and ensure all components are undamaged.Validate the calibration and settings before use.
Electrical Assessment:
Use a multimeter to examine voltage outputs and confirm that circuits are functioning generally.Examine ground connections to avoid electrical shocks.
Arc Stability Test:
Set the machine to advised settings and initiate an arc.Observe arc behavior for stability, length, and any variations throughout the operation.
Load Testing:
Run the machine continuously at full capability for a specific duration, typically around 30 minutes.Monitor performance for any indications of struggling or unusual behavior.
Thermal Assessment:
Use a thermal imaging cam or thermometer to determine temperatures during and after the load test.Recognize hotspots that could show possible failures.
Sturdiness Testing:
Subject the machine to duplicated cycles of operation to mimic extended use.Examine wear and tear on different components.
Last Analysis:
Compile data obtained from the tests.Examine outcomes against suitable standards to figure out efficiency levels.Maintenance Tips After Testing
